Hyderabad, July 23 -- The Supreme Court on Wednesday, July 23, criticised the Telangana government for destroying the Kancha Gachibowli forest land overnight, stating that such actions cannot be justified in the name of sustainable development.

The bench comprised of Chief Justice of IndiaBR Gavaiand JusticesVinod ChandranandJoymalya Bagchi.

CJI slams Telangana govt

Hearing the case, CJI BR Gavai remarked, "I am myself an advocate for sustainable development, but that doesn't mean that overnight you should employ 30 bulldozers and clear all the jungle," reported Bar and Bench.
